Managing museum projects without a clear timeline creates confusion and missed opportunities. Everything feels urgent, yet nothing feels organized.
Here’s what often trips up museum teams without a visual timeline:
- Long-term exhibition plans become blurry — hard to track what’s underway, delayed, or upcoming.
- Artifact conservation schedules get overlooked — no clear overview of maintenance or restoration stages.
- Event coordination falters — overlapping tasks and unclear deadlines cause last-minute scrambles.
- Team communication fragments — scattered emails and notes lead to misalignment.
- Vendor and contractor timelines get missed — delays in deliveries or installations go unnoticed.
- Resource allocation conflicts arise — equipment and space bookings collide without a timeline.
- Progress visibility suffers — months of work feel stuck without clear indicators.
- Compliance and permit deadlines slip by — leading to operational risks and fines.
